- The distance between Trincomalee, Sri Lanka and Eskisehir, Turkey is approximately 6,089 km or 3,784 mi.
- To reach Trincomalee in this distance one would set out from Eskisehir bearing 110.5°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Trincomalee bearing 133.3° or SE .
- Trincomalee has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As) whereas Eskisehir has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- The mean temperature is 17.4 °C (31.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17 °C (30.6°F) less in Trincomalee.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1181.2 mm (46.5 in) more which is equivalent to 1181.2 l/m² (28.99 US gal/ft²) or 11,812,000 l/ha (1,262,781 US gal/ac) more. About 4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.7° higher in Trincomalee than in Eskisehir.
